EDIT: I found the post thank you Father  . It was in the Evo section of the Mikmik forums. I guess I will post it, in case someone needs the info;
"Anyway, you just need two things. One is the mod you want, so you'll need to download steal25's mod, two is Ninjamorph, its a free app on the market. Oh, you'll also need a file explorer. Root explorer is the best but es will do. Use the file explorer to extract the systemui apk from steal25's zip. Go to the extracted apk, long press and extract all. Make sure the extracted files are in an easy to find area. Exit the file explorer. Launch ninjamorph, authorize superuser, and start checks. Then select new project, go to system, then apps, and select systemui apk. When the select item you'd like to change comes up, select res, then select layout, and find and select the statusbar.xml. Then it will ask you to select the item to replace it with, navigate to where you put the extracted files from the mod, and go select the modded statusbar.xml. You won't need to make any other changes, so hit back after it applies, then hit finish project and select the newly modded systemui.apk. Hit yes to overwrite, yes to zipalign, and no to clean up. Then your phone will start acting crazy, its ok it happens when you change stuff in that apk with this app. Just yank the battery and reboot." - (urrgevo)
